Handover: ParityScope rate-parity checker

ParityScope scrapes published rates across the Lanternhouse hotel group's channels and flags discrepancies over 2%. Credentials rotate weekly via the Vaultwren service; the scraper runs in an isolated subnet with egress limited to an allowlist. Known gaps: the headless browser pool runs an older runtime, and the comparison API lacks rate limiting. Both are tracked for Q3. Logs retain raw responses for 14 days. For access grants, threat questions, or incident response, contact the new owner named below.

approver of yajef-fajef = Oliwyn Silion Kasok Kasox

Unsigned files are quarantined automatically and deleted after seven days. Place your plugin archive and its detached signature in your assigned incoming directory; the ingest job runs hourly and validates both files together. If validation fails, you'll see a rejection notice in your outbox directory with the reason attached. The ingest service verifies all uploads against the platform's current public verification key, which is provided below.

deploy key for bajog-kageg: bky4_TaoL

## Broker Upgrade — Reviewer Notes

This fragment covers the Perchline message broker upgrade from 4.x to 5.0. Reviewers should confirm the migration script drains all queues before the version swap and that consumer offsets are checkpointed to the Larkmoor archive cluster. The upgrade bundle is signed by the platform team, and the deploy pipeline refuses unsigned bundles. Check that the pipeline config references the current key, not the deprecated 4.x one. The active deploy key follows.

signing key of yahag-hahap = bky19_fv6WaqDUcbASx8HTGob

**Q: Why are Fernwick build agents failing signature checks after the weekend?**

Clock skew. Agents in the Drossel pool drift up to 45 seconds when the NTP relay restarts, which invalidates timestamped artifacts. Resync all agents before cutting a release, then re-run the signing stage. If the relay itself is wedged, you must restart it manually, which requires the recovery passphrase printed below.

vault phrase of bagaf-kajeg = jorath-feniel-briir-siliel-ralix